Combination nepafenac, dexamethasone treatment reduces macular inflammation

Treatment with a combination of topical nepafenac and dexamethasone reduced macular swelling and inflammation in patients after cataract surgery, according to study findings. The prospective study included 152 patients who were at low risk for postoperative inflammation after cataract surgery. Seventy-five patients were randomly assigned to receive nepafenac ophthalmic suspension 0.1% in combination with dexamethasone 0.1%, and 77 patients were randomly assigned to receive dexamethasone 0.1% and placebo. The researchers used optical coherence tomography to assess patients’ postoperative swelling of the macula.
